After a number of guest appearances on The Beverly Hillbillies, The Rifleman and other shows, he was cast as the father of two boys in Flipper, which also starred a dolphin as the title character. His father Harry Kelly was an extraordinarily distinguished lawyer who served as Michigan's Secretary of State and two-term governor as well as serving seventeen years on the state's supreme court. Although Brian took a back seat to the scene-stealing antics of the titular dolphin and the two actors (Luke Halpin and Tommy Norden) playing his sons, fans admired the actor's widower character on the series who provided a strong moral fiber to his children.
